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
277974872 8384 65807
30764846417 758
30764846417 758
209578 8568119 18053750724
All about undefined
Interested in learning more?
30764846417 758
209578 8568119 18053750724
See more
75212225742 63969809902 02
9153 746 318752263
See more
3898229239 61960067 844655734
11 7239150 367 846850 4942
See more